**Product Range and Features**

Siless offers a variety of sound deadening products, including:

1. **Butyl Rubber Mat**: A dense, closed-cell rubber mat that provides excellent vibration damping and sound absorption. It is often used under flooring, in walls, and ceilings.

2. **Mass Loaded Vinyl (MLV)**: A thin, flexible sheet that is dense and heavy, making it effective at blocking sound transmission through walls and ceilings.

3. **Acoustic Foam**: Designed to absorb sound reflections, these foam panels are ideal for treating rooms with excessive echo and reverberation.

4. **Soundproofing Sealant**: Used to seal gaps and cracks, this sealant helps prevent sound from leaking through small openings.

**Application Process**

Applying Siless Sound Deadening products is generally straightforward:

- **Surface Preparation**: Ensure the surface is clean, dry, and free of loose material.
- **Cutting to Size**: Cut the material to fit the desired area, using a utility knife for precision.
- **Installation**: Apply the material using adhesive, nails, or screws, depending on the product and surface.
- **Sealing**: Use the soundproofing sealant to seal any gaps around windows, doors, and edges.

**Effectiveness**

The effectiveness of Siless Sound Deadening products varies depending on the material and the specific noise issue. For instance, butyl rubber is excellent for reducing impact noise, while MLV is more effective against airborne noise. Acoustic foam panels are best suited for treating rooms with high reverberation.
